Unit Markings;
Last week end at an auction, I bought two more Lugers. (This seems to be happening every weekend lately). One is a 1910 DWM, number 1186c matching numbers in the military range but are located in the commercial style. Military proofs one of which I have not seen before. Looks something like a crown over a stylized 3. It has the hold open devise fitted with an arsenal proof along side the hold open pin. (as per the description on page 160 of Mr. Kenyons Lugers at Random.) Is this a first Issue? The unit marks are 117.R.M.G. 22. The second is a 1916 DWM Artillery model serial number 7297a with unit marks 95R.2K.46. Can anyone help with some information please, Murray, Great Barrier Island New Zealand. |
